1.Julia is a small bakery shop owner producing and selling cakes. Recently, she successfully secured a contract to supply cupcakes for five weddings in a month. Luckily all five customer order the signature menu that is VS Cupcake. However, an issue arise when she has low stock on strawberry compote, which is one of the main ingredient. Due to high number of orders, she decide to purchase ready made strawberry compote rather than make it from scratch like usual. To help guide her decision, she has assembled product costing information as the following to make 5kg strawberry compote:

RM

Variable cost:

Strawberry 350

Sugar

100

Lemon juice

50

Fixed Cost

Electricity

120

Kitchen helper

100

Depreciation of kitchen equipment

50

Total Cost

770

At the same time, she has been offered to purchase it at RM600 by SCW Sdn Bhd, a new supplier which she has never worked with before. Her regular supplier was unable to provide the goods at a short period of time.

Required:

a.Specify the accuracy of product costing given in the question and its appropriateness to support decision making.(2 marks)

b.Provide two (2) recommendation supported with calculations that is considered, as necessary.(4 marks)

c.Justify two (2) factors to be considered before final decision is made. (4 marks)
